Robert “Jack” Johnson of Covington, passed away June 19, 2010, at the age of 78. Mr. Johnson served his country as a Corporal in the United States Army during the Korean War. He retired from Bibb Manufacturing Company after 47 years, and attended Stewart Baptist Church for many years. He loved all types of cars; was an avid vegetable and flower gardener, and enjoyed sharing his vegetables with everyone. Mr. Johnson loved animals, especially dogs, and enjoyed working on his farm. He was preceded in death by his parents, Howard J. and Lucille (Slaughter) Johnson. Survivors include his loving wife of 59 years, Mattie Lou (Walden) Johnson; daughter and son-in-law, Regina Johnson (Cliff) Prosser; granddaughter, Christy Prosser; brothers, Bill Johnson, Idus Johnson, all of Covington.
